    Thank you all. I have a Transcends auto with 2 c-100 battery packs. I use a mobile adaptor to convert the 12 volts to 19volts. Get 5 days out of the batteries. I choose these batteries because they work with my bed side machine. Works great, just need a way to hang it all and still use my integrated bug net.
